Subject: Hiring freeze — Meridale division

Hi all, quick heads-up: we're pausing all new hires in the Meridale division effective Monday. Open offers already signed will be honored; everything else goes on hold. Please route any exception requests through me directly rather than HR. Context matters here, so read the confidential note below:

internal memo for faweg-tafog: Only 7 of the 100 pilot accounts renewed Quenael, so a churn review is set for April 15.

The Pipewren deploy-status bot stopped posting updates to the release channel after yesterday's webhook migration. Root cause: the bot still queries the legacy Quarrel CI endpoint, which now returns 410 for all status requests. The fix in this PR swaps to the v3 polling client and adds a retry cap. Verified against the staging deploy that reproduced the silence; its token is below.

pipeline stamp: htk31_f769b577b3028a4e9958e5bb8d1259a

Onboarding note: Undo/redo in the Sketchfen diagram editor is handled by a command stack in the client, synced to the collab service. Each user action is a reversible command; the stack caps at 200 entries per session. If users report undo "skipping" steps, it's usually a failed sync ack — check the collab service logs first, not the client. Do not clear the stack table manually. The full architecture walkthrough and debugging checklist are on this internal page.

wiki page, tahaf-tajog: https://jira.ordindyn.corp/pipeline

## Meeting notes — Bounceline processor review

- Hard bounces now quarantined after one failure; soft bounces retry 3x with backoff.
- Parser rewritten to handle multiline SMTP codes; old regex removed.
- Dead-letter queue drained nightly, metrics wired to the Lanternview dashboard.
- Review focus: retry idempotency and the suppression-list write path.
- Tests cover malformed MIME headers; add cases for truncated payloads before approval.
- PR is open and blocked on review. Direct all questions to the owner listed below.

account owner for bawip-tahag: Raleth Quenok